The 2025 U23 World Championships are the next big international event on the schedule. They will be held on Oct. 20 through 27, in Novi Sad, Serbia.

UWW has a preview up on their site. It had this to say about 65kg

65kg: In one of the toughest weight classes at the U23 level, world bronze medalist Umidjon JALOLOV (UZB), two-time world U20 champion Yuto NISHIUCHI (JPN), world U20 champion Marcus BLAZE (USA), two-time world U23 champion Bashir MAGOMEDOV (UWW), returning medalist Bilol SHARIP UULU (KGZ) and senior continental medalists Khamzat ARSAMERZOUEV (FRA) and SUJEET (IND) are in the field.

I knew the weight was deep but this is absolutely stacked! Some really great guys aren’t going to place. The draw will be super important

An overview of the schedule of the 2025 U23 Worlds:

Monday (10/20)
- qualification rounds to semis for Greco, @ 63-77-87-130 kg

Tuesday (10/21)
- repechage for Greco, @ 63-77-87-130 kg
- qualification rounds to semis for Greco, @ 55-67-72-97 kg
- finals for Greco, @ 63-77-87-130 kg

Wednesday (10/22)
- repechage for Greco, @ 55-67-72-97 kg
- qualification rounds to semis for Greco, @ 60-82 kg
- qualification rounds to semis for Women's Wrestling, @ 50-72-76 kg
- finals for Greco, @ 55-67-72-97 kg

Thursday (10/23)
- repechage for Greco, @ 60-82 kg
- repechage for Women's Wrestling, @ 50-72-76 kg
- qualification rounds to semis for Women's Wrestling, @ 55-57-65-68 kg
- finals for Greco, @ 60-82 kg
- finals for Women's Wrestling, @ 50-72-76 kg

Friday (10/24)
- repechage for Women's Wrestling, @ 55-57-65-68 kg
- qualification rounds to semis for Men's FS, @ 74-92 kg
- qualification rounds to semis for Women's Wrestling, @ 53-59-62 kg
- finals for Women's Wrestling, @ 55-57-65-68 kg

Saturday (10/25)
- repechage for Men's FS, @ 74-92 kg
- repechage for Women's FS, @ 53-59-62 kg
- qualification rounds to semis for Men's FS, @ 57-70-79-125 kg
- finals for Men's FS, @ 74-92 kg
- finals for Women's Wrestling, @ 53-59-62 kg

Sunday (10/26)
- repechage for Men's FS, @ 57-70-79-125 kg
- qualification rounds to semis for Men's FS, @ 61-65-86-97 kg
- finals for Men's FS, @ 57-70-79-125 kg

Monday (10/27)
- repechage for Men's FS, @ 61-65-86-97 kg
- finals for Men's FS, @ 61-65-86-97 kg

I was looking deeper at 65kg and Sujeet Sujeet might just be the favorite. He was 8th at seniors and he only lost to Amouzad 6-5 and Woods 7-5. Amouzad absolutely destroyed everyone else. He won U23 Asians where he beat Jalolov twice by the scores 10-1 and 10-0. He also won a ranking series event where he teched Dudaev, teched Arsamerzouev, beat Tevanyan 6-1, and Rahmadze 5-1. Pretty incredible results for just the past year. Many have JALOLOV as the favorite because he won bronze at seniors but Sujeet definitely has his number. He also has an 8-2 win over Yianni from a couple years ago. I think Blaze matches up pretty well because of his defense but he will be giving up a ton of size
